Slump Be Gone

What can say about last night? The Red Sox’s hitting slump continued, as Toronto’s pitching looked very strong. You got a taste of why many had Toronto taking the division this year – Halladay, McGowan, and Burnett putting zeros on the scoreboard late into the game.

Besides the strangest call I have seen in a long time (balk call on Ryan’s last pitch of the game), there wasn’t too much to get excited about.

I’m not too sure if I like the new camera angle NESN threw out there last night. It may take some getting use to, but my biggest gripe is not being able to see who Dennis Drinkwater invited to the game.

Random question: Doesn’t BJ Ryan look like Mike Timlin plus 30-35lbs?

The Rays are in town tonight, and it’s clearly time for the reigning World Series Champs to set some order to this division. It may not be a bad idea to unleash Tavarez tonight and set the mood for the weekend.

Matchups:

  • Buchholz against Jackson tonight (7:05pm)
  • Beckett against Shields on Saturday (7:05pm)
  • Sunday will have Lester facing Kazmir (1:35pm)
